Summarizing the Alec Pierce (ankle) situation: 1. Been managing discomfort in left ankle since 2024 2. Admitted he was rarely playing at 100% 3. Got a PRP injection at end of 2025 season 4. PRP injection didn't help 5. Colts sign Pierce to a 4-year, $114M deal with $84M guaranteed 6. Undergoes surgery on left ankle 7. On active/PUP to open camp, goal is to be ready Wk 1 8. Healthy Colts WRs are Josh Downs, Ashton Dulin, Nick Westbrook-Ikhine, Deion Burks 9. Colts beat writers have speculated...

ESPN projecting ARZ to keep all four RBs on the 53: 1. Jeremiyah Love 2. Tyler Allgeier 3. James Conner 4. Trey Benson Seems wild to tie up this much capital at the position. James Conner or Trey Benson to a RB-needy team, in exchange for a R7 pick, makes sense. Especially since Conner and Benson don't play special teams. <https://www.espn.com/nfl/story/_/id/49084086/2026-arizona-cardinals-nfl-training-camp-preview>

(via ESPN) Very clean setup for Kenneth Walker: * Leaves SEA in part because they limited his touches * KC shows intent to go workhorse with 3-year, $43M deal * Goes to offense where the QB play forces defenders deep * Backups are Emari Demercado, Emmett Johnson, Brashard Smith * Thorn's No. 8 offensive line

Favorites in the Stefon Diggs "sweepstakes" as camp approaches: 1. Commanders -- Current WR2 is Treylon Burks, slot is (hopefully) Antonio Williams 2. Chiefs -- Need more weapons for Patrick Mahomes, behind short-area Rashee Rice and vertical Xavier Worthy 3. Rams -- Current WR3 in Super Bowl window is Jordan Whittington/Konata Mumpfield 4. Ravens -- Earth's preeminent collector of former superstar WRs who are some degree of withered

Lamar Jackson is going around 55 overall. Just 16 picks before Caleb Williams. Plenty of room for 29-year-old Lamar to beat ADP if we're willing to chalk up 2025 rushing decline to injury. Rush attempts per game, by season: 2018: 9.2 2019: 11.7 2020: 10.6 2021: 11.1 2022: 9.3 2023: 9.3 2024: 8.2 **2025: 5.1 (hamstring, ankle, toe, back)** We are middling Lamar rushing a bit in projection, we're nowhere near his 2019-21 form.
